mirror of
https://github.com/crewAIInc/crewAI.git
synced 2026-04-10 04:52:40 +00:00
62 lines
2.5 KiB
Plaintext
62 lines
2.5 KiB
Plaintext
---
|
|
title: Ferramentas de Codificação
|
|
description: Use o AGENTS.md para guiar agentes de codificação e IDEs em seus projetos CrewAI.
|
|
icon: terminal
|
|
mode: "wide"
|
|
---
|
|
|
|
## Por que AGENTS.md
|
|
|
|
`AGENTS.md` é um arquivo de instruções leve e local do repositório que fornece aos agentes de codificação orientações consistentes e específicas do projeto. Mantenha-o na raiz do projeto e trate-o como a fonte da verdade para como você deseja que os assistentes trabalhem: convenções, comandos, notas de arquitetura e proteções.
|
|
|
|
## Criar um Projeto com o CLI
|
|
|
|
Use o CLI do CrewAI para criar a estrutura de um projeto, e o `AGENTS.md` será automaticamente adicionado na raiz.
|
|
|
|
```bash
|
|
# Crew
|
|
crewai create crew my_crew
|
|
|
|
# Flow
|
|
crewai create flow my_flow
|
|
|
|
# Tool repository
|
|
crewai tool create my_tool
|
|
```
|
|
|
|
## Configuração de Ferramentas: Direcione Assistentes para o AGENTS.md
|
|
|
|
### Codex
|
|
|
|
O Codex pode ser guiado por arquivos `AGENTS.md` colocados no seu repositório. Use-os para fornecer contexto persistente do projeto, como convenções, comandos e expectativas de fluxo de trabalho.
|
|
|
|
### Claude Code
|
|
|
|
O Claude Code armazena a memória do projeto em `CLAUDE.md`. Você pode inicializá-lo com `/init` e editá-lo usando `/memory`. O Claude Code também suporta importações dentro do `CLAUDE.md`, então você pode adicionar uma única linha como `@AGENTS.md` para incluir as instruções compartilhadas sem duplicá-las.
|
|
|
|
Você pode simplesmente usar:
|
|
|
|
```bash
|
|
mv AGENTS.md CLAUDE.md
|
|
```
|
|
|
|
### Gemini CLI e Google Antigravity
|
|
|
|
O Gemini CLI e o Antigravity carregam um arquivo de contexto do projeto (padrão: `GEMINI.md`) da raiz do repositório e diretórios pais. Você pode configurá-lo para ler o `AGENTS.md` em vez disso (ou além) definindo `context.fileName` nas configurações do Gemini CLI. Por exemplo, defina apenas para `AGENTS.md`, ou inclua tanto `AGENTS.md` quanto `GEMINI.md` se quiser manter o formato de cada ferramenta.
|
|
|
|
Você pode simplesmente usar:
|
|
|
|
```bash
|
|
mv AGENTS.md GEMINI.md
|
|
```
|
|
|
|
### Cursor
|
|
|
|
O Cursor suporta `AGENTS.md` como arquivo de instruções do projeto. Coloque-o na raiz do projeto para fornecer orientação ao assistente de codificação do Cursor.
|
|
|
|
### Windsurf
|
|
|
|
O Claude Code fornece uma integração oficial com o Windsurf. Se você usa o Claude Code dentro do Windsurf, siga a orientação do Claude Code acima e importe o `AGENTS.md` a partir do `CLAUDE.md`.
|
|
|
|
Se você está usando o assistente nativo do Windsurf, configure o recurso de regras ou instruções do projeto (se disponível) para ler o `AGENTS.md` ou cole o conteúdo diretamente.
|